3. Getting Ready for Your Interviews

Preparation at Sanumas Solutions should be focused on demonstrating your ability to apply your expertise to concrete engineering problems. We look for candidates who can articulate their technical decisions clearly and show a genuine interest in the intersection of software, design, and manufacturing.

Technical Proficiency – We assess your command of the tools and languages relevant to your specialization. Be prepared to explain not just how to use a tool, but why you chose a specific approach or configuration to achieve a desired outcome.

Analytical Rigor – We value engineers who can break down complex systems into manageable parts. You should be able to demonstrate a systematic approach to debugging, designing, or troubleshooting, showing that you consider edge cases and long-term maintainability.

Operational Awareness – Understanding the impact of your work on the broader production environment is essential. Successful candidates demonstrate an awareness of how their code or design influences machine uptime, material efficiency, and overall project costs.

8. Frequently Asked Questions

Q: How long does the interview process typically take? The process varies by team, but most candidates move through the stages within a few weeks. We aim to keep the process efficient while ensuring we have enough time to evaluate your technical skills thoroughly.

Q: What is the best way to prepare for the technical portion? Focus on your past projects. Be ready to explain the "why" behind your technical decisions and how you handled specific challenges or failures.

Q: Does Sanumas Solutions offer remote work? The nature of our engineering work, particularly roles involving machinery or on-site support, often requires being in the office or on the production floor.

Q: What differentiates successful candidates? Successful candidates demonstrate a balance of deep technical expertise and a practical, proactive approach to solving real-world manufacturing problems.

9. Other General Tips

  • Structure your answers: When describing a project, use the situation-action-result format to ensure your contribution is clear.
  • Be honest about your limitations: If you don't know the answer to a specific technical question, explain how you would go about finding the solution.
  • Show your work: If you have a portfolio or examples of your designs/code, be prepared to talk through them in detail.
  • Research our output: Understand the types of machines and products we work on to demonstrate your alignment with our business goals.

What kind of projects and case studies should I prepare for Sanumas Solutions Software Engineer interviews?
You should prepare to discuss specific past projects in detail, including the challenges you faced and the technical trade-offs you made. The Project Discussion stage is described as an in-depth look at your work, including how you reasoned through constraints. The Case Study Review stage focuses on analyzing case studies relevant to the team to assess practical problem-solving.
How does Sanumas Solutions evaluate problem-solving and engineering process for Software Engineer candidates?
They assess analytical rigor, including breaking down complex systems and showing systematic debugging, troubleshooting, or design steps. Operational awareness matters too, because your work impacts machine uptime, material efficiency, and overall project costs. Expect questions that involve handling changes mid-project, resolving discrepancies between design and prototype, and balancing quality with tight deadlines.
